答:如果数组中的值是基本类型, 改变不了;如果是引用类型分两种情况:1、没有修改形参元素的地址值, 只是修改形参元素内部的某些属性,会改变原数组;2、直接修改整个元素对象时,无法改变原数组; JavaScrip
转载
2023-07-11 18:37:48
367阅读
# 如何在Java中使用foreach循环
作为一名经验丰富的开发者,我将向你介绍如何在Java中使用foreach循环,并解答你的问题:“Java foreach能不能用beak”。
## 流程概览
下面是完成该任务的流程图,以便更好地理解整个过程:
```mermaid
flowchart TD
Start(开始)
Step1(创建一个数组或集合)
Step2(
原创
2024-01-23 12:36:57
52阅读
一.概念for:for循环是用下标索引,对数组或集合的元素进行确定的。foreach:1、foreach适用于数组或实现了iterator的集合类。foreach就是使用Iterator接口来实现对集合的遍历的。2、在用foreach循环遍历一个集合时,不能使用集合自带的方法改变集合中的元素,如增加元素、删除元素。否则会抛出ConcurrentModificationException异常。也不能
转载
2023-08-20 09:10:18
358阅读
前言Mysql数据库是当前应用最为的广泛的数据库,在实际工作中也经常接触到。真正用好mysql也不仅仅是会写sql就行,更重要的是真正理解其内部的工作原理。本文先从宏观角度介绍一些mysql相关的知识点,目的是为了让大家对mysql能有一个大体上的认知,后续再逐一对每个知识点的进行深入解读。通信方式Mysql采用了典型的客户端/服务器架构(C/S架构)模式。对于计算机而言,数据库客户端程序和服务器
# Java构造方法能否重写能否重载
在Java中,构造方法是一种特殊的方法,用于实例化一个对象。构造方法的名称必须与类名相同,并且没有返回类型。在本文中,我们将讨论构造方法是否可以重写和重载的问题。
## 什么是重写和重载
在Java中,重写(override)指的是子类重新定义父类中的方法。重载(overload)指的是在同一个类中定义多个具有相同名称但参数列表不同的方法。
## 构造
原创
2024-05-01 03:47:02
157阅读
# Android AAR能否修改代码?新手开发者的指南
在 Android 开发中,AAR(Android Archive)是一种用于重用代码的特定格式。AAR 文件是一种可以包含 Android 资源和一个或多个类库的封装格式。由于 AAR 文件是已经打包好的,所以直接在项目中使用它们时,无法直接修改其内部代码。若想要对 AAR 文件中的代码进行修改,需采取一些特定步骤。本文将详细阐述如何修
关于软考信息修改的深度探讨
在信息技术迅猛发展的今天,软件行业作为其中的核心组成部分,越来越受到人们的关注。为了对软件专业技术人员的专业水平进行统一衡量和管理,我国设立了软件水平考试(简称软考)。软考不仅是一个评价个人能力的平台,更是企事业单位选拔人才的重要参考。因此,确保软考信息的准确性和完整性至关重要。
那么,软考报名后能否修改信息呢?这是许多考生和准备参加考试的人们非常关心的问题。毕竟,
原创
2024-03-05 11:51:24
62阅读
关于软考报名结束后信息修改的问题探讨
在信息技术迅猛发展的今天,软件行业作为国家经济发展的重要支柱,其专业人才的认证与培养显得尤为重要。软件水平考试(简称软考)作为我国软件行业最具权威性的专业认证考试之一,每年都吸引着大批的IT从业者及爱好者参与。然而,在报名过程中,不少考生由于种种原因,可能会在报名截止后发现自己的报名信息存在错误或需要修改,这时他们往往会感到焦虑和困惑,不知道该如何处理。
原创
2024-03-20 12:17:11
21阅读
### 如何修改Android Surface的宽高
作为一名经验丰富的开发者,我将向你介绍如何在Android中修改Surface的宽高。首先,我将展示这个过程的步骤,并解释每一步需要做什么以及需要使用的代码。接着,我将为你提供一个类图和甘特图,以帮助你更好地理解这一过程。
#### 步骤
下面是完成这个任务的步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 获
原创
2024-03-21 05:46:53
138阅读
# Java能不能不写new
Java是一种面向对象的编程语言,它的特点之一就是需要使用`new`关键字来实例化对象。但是,在某些情况下,我们可以通过其他方式来创建对象,避免使用`new`关键字。本文将介绍在Java中创建对象的几种方式,并且探讨它们的优缺点。
## 1. 使用`new`关键字创建对象
在Java中,使用`new`关键字可以直接实例化一个对象。下面是一个示例代码:
```j
原创
2023-09-08 05:05:10
97阅读
# Java能够操控硬件吗?
Java是一种广泛使用的编程语言,具有跨平台的特性,因此被广泛应用于各种应用程序的开发中。然而,由于Java的运行环境是基于虚拟机的,因此一直有人怀疑Java是否能够操控硬件。本文将详细介绍Java在操控硬件方面的能力,并给出相应的代码示例来说明。
## Java操控硬件的基本原理
Java操控硬件的基本原理是通过JNI(Java Native Interfac
原创
2023-08-04 09:13:36
330阅读
项目相关要求项目地址:https://github.com/xiawork/wcwork
实现一个统计程序,它能正确统计程序文件中的字符数、单词数、行数,以及还具备其他扩展功能,并能够快速地处理多个文件。
具体功能要求:基本功能列表: wc.exe -c file.c //返回文件 file.c 的字符数 wc.exe -w file.c //返回文件 file.c 的词的数目
JavaSE6.0下的Web Service 从JavaSE6.0开始,Java引入了对Web Service的原生支持。我们只需要简单的使用Java的Annotation标签即可将标准的Java方法发布成Web Service。(PS:Java Annotation资料请参考 JDK5.0 Annotation学习笔记(一) ) 但不是所有的Java类都可以发布成Web Service。Java
转载
2024-09-20 07:39:52
29阅读
# Java 计算能不能除尽
在进行数学计算时,我们经常会遇到除法运算。在Java编程中,我们可以使用除法运算符“/”来进行除法计算。但是有时候我们需要判断两个数能否被整除,也就是除尽的情况。在本文中,我们将介绍如何在Java中判断两个数能否被整除,并提供相应的代码示例。
## 能否被除尽的判断方法
在数学中,如果一个数能够被另一个数整除,那么它们的余数应该为0。因此,在Java中,我们可以
原创
2024-05-16 06:49:35
62阅读
# Java是否能够收邮件?
Java是一种广泛使用的编程语言,被用于开发各种类型的应用程序,包括网络应用程序。当涉及到电子邮件的功能时,Java也提供了一些强大的库和API来实现收发邮件的功能。在本文中,我们将详细介绍Java如何实现邮件收取功能,并提供相关代码示例。
## Java邮件库
Java提供了许多不同的库和API来处理电子邮件。其中最常用的是JavaMail库,它是一个开源库,
原创
2023-12-01 12:59:42
46阅读
kali2020.1默没有root用户,可以使用普通用户我安装时出现的问题:我安装时选择图形安装,但是安装完后,是命令行界面,安装后什么软件都没有本篇只说明如何安装kali,不讲准备工作。因为VM,VirtualBox,双系统等安装方式都一样你可以直接按照图片来安装开始安装 如果没有的话,默认为空,按继续 选择整块磁盘 选择是 等待安装基本系统,要好一会,可以睡一觉 一般在这就有区别:配置程序包管
大家好啊,我是summo,今天给大家分享一下我平时是怎么调试代码的,不是权威也不是教学,就是简单分享一下,如果大家还有更好的调试方式也可以多多交流哦。如果看过我文章的同学应该知道我是一个Java开发,平时都是Spring全家桶。后端和前端虽说都是写代码,但调代码的时候还是有点不同的,前端可以console.log一把梭,但是Java只用 System.out.println是不行的,原因也很简单,
一:Join 的问题? - 在实际生产中,使用 join 一般会集中在以下两类: - DBA 不让使用 Join ,使用 Join 会有什么问题呢? - 如果有两个大小不同的表做 join,应该用哪个表做驱动表呢? 二:数据准备CREATE TABLE `t2` (
`id` int(11) NOT NULL,
`a` int(11) DEFAU
转载
2023-12-02 14:36:39
69阅读
# Sublime Text能否运行Java?
在现代编程中,选择合适的代码编辑器十分重要。Sublime Text是一个广受欢迎的文本编辑器,因其简洁高效的界面和丰富的功能受到了众多开发者的青睐。但不少初学者对Sublime Text和Java的结合使用有一些疑问:Sublime Text能不能直接运行Java程序?
## 什么是Sublime Text?
Sublime Text是一款跨
# Xcode能否编写Java应用程序?
作为一名刚入行的小白,在探索开发工具和编程语言时,你可能会问“能不能使用Xcode编写Java应用程序?”答案是虽然Xcode并不是Java的原生开发环境,但你仍然可以通过安装一些工具和插件在Xcode中编写和运行Java。不过,通常建议使用其他IDE,如Eclipse或IntelliJ IDEA来专门开发Java应用程序。不过如果你想在Xcode中尝试